The artist and his influence Anne-Louis Girodet-Trioson, an emblematic figure of Neoclassicism, marked his era with his undeniable talent and originality. A pupil of Jacques-Louis David, he knew how to break free from established norms to forge a style that is uniquely his own. His work reflects a time seeking identity, where art becomes a means of expressing human passions and social conflicts. Girodet, through his bold iconographic choices and refined technique, managed to capture the collective imagination of his time.
